1. |
Drain the coolant.
(Refer to Engine Mechanical System - "Coolant")
|
2. |
Remove the air cleaner assembly and air duct.
(Refer to Engine Mechanical System - "Air cleaner")
|
3. |
Remove the battery and battery tray.
(Refer to Engine Electrical System - "Battery")
|
4. |
Remove the under cover.
(Refer to Engine Mechanical System - "Engine Room Under Cover")
|
5. |
Disconnect the coolant hose (B) after removing the coolant hose
clamp (A).
|
6. |
Disconnect the hose (B) after removing the automatic transaxle
fluid cooler hose clamp (A).
|
7. |
Remove the ATF Warmer (A).
